Electronic components are often mounted with good heat conduction paths to a finned aluminum base plate, which is exposed to a stream of cooling air from a fan. The sum of the mass times specific heat products for a base plate and components is 5000 J/K, and the effective heat transfer coefficient times surface area product is 10 W/K. The initial temperature of the plate and the cooling air temperature are 295 K when 300 W of power are switched on. Find the plate temperature after 10 minutes. Find the steady temperature of the components.Explanation / Answer
a) total heat supplied = change in temp + heat loss
W x t = mcT + hAT
300 x 10 x 60 = 5000(T - 295) + 10(T - 295) x 10 x 60
T = 311.363 K
b)at steady state, total heat supplied is equal to total energy loss
W = hAT
300 = 10(T - 295)
T = 325 K
